DVD TV SERIES/DOCUMENTARY OF THE WEEK

My choice for TV Series/Documentary of the week is “Never Sleep Again: The Elm Street Legacy.” This in depth documentary covers the entire horror franchise as well as interviews on the new film. Runner up this week is the Ronald D. Moore science fiction TV movie, “Virtuality.”

The 2009, R rated drama/comedy “Shrink” starring Kevin Spacey is my Rental/Used DVD of the week.
Henry Carter (Spacey) is L.A.’s top celebrity psychiatrist. Problem is he’s self medicating with pot, while struggling with his own mid-life career crisis. Everything changes one day when a pro bono case turns into a unexpected life changing event.
This is one of those quirky “Hollywood life” films that delivers a interesting story with some often deep and hilarious characters. Great performances by Spacey of course, as well as Keke Palmer and Dallas Roberts. There’s also an unexpected un credited performance by Robin Williams that added a sense of wtf surealness to the film.
Spacey fans will want to purchase this one, everyone else I recommend “Shrink” as a solid rental. Rated R, mainly for drug use and explicit language. DVD includes, Director (Jonas Pate) audio commentary as well as several interviews and a Jackson Browne music video. I picked it up at (FreakBeat Records) in the Valley for $5 bucks used.
